These are the last mouthpieces that Selmer made in the '70s with the classic horseshoe/cathedral style chamber configuration before adopting the square chamber of the S-80 series that eventually started coming with the Mark VII saxophones

This piece features a heavy step baffle that opens up nicely into a very large chamber for a powerful and full sounding combination
